			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>I was deeply involved in many writing projects in the early part of 1996, while also focusing on planning for my business.  Around this time, I also began to notice that some literary publications were becoming interested in very short pieces of fiction.  This is one of my early attempts at such&#8230; and nearly 13 years later, this is its first appearance.</p>

<p>STOP COUNTING</p>
<p>by Roger Darnell</center><br />Part of the way through that fourth period, I started getting really hungry.  It seemed like the bell would never ring and I thought for a minute about how long it had taken for them to finally get the new McDonalds open.  Just about then, if I&#8217;m not crazy, the teacher stopped whatever he had been doing and looked right into me, but he didn’t say anything.  It was spooky, but I just kept waiting.  Then, he started talking to the class again, very slowly, explaining that the earth has existed for, like millions of years.  I completely felt the gravity of each word.  He didn’t look at me again, but finally the bell did ring and I tore out of there, right out into the snow.  At last, school was finished for me; I’d have to explain to Mom about the teacher.  Obviously, he knew, and would have to be dealt with immediately.</p>
